IFComp 2023 had a couple, and they reminded me of another I tested in Shufflecomp. I like having the ability to leave when I want and see what I want.
I'm looking specifically for ones with no winning or losing, and ones where you can end the game by leaving, no matter how much you've seen, are also particularly valuable. (There's a lot of overlap.) Though a score of how much you've seen is worthwhile.
Deborah Sherwood's The Finder's Commission, also in IFComp 2023, misses the cut for this poll, despite mostly being in a museum. You spend time in your own hideout/headquarters. Though having a museum caper is okay!
Hannes Schueller's Ninja's Fate would also miss the cut. It is like the other entries in spirit, but again, you do important things outside the museum.
